Transport Options

Traveling from Cleveland to Traverse City, approximately 478 km apart, offers several transportation options. The fastest way is by flight, taking about 1.5 hours of air time, but factoring in airport procedures, total travel time can extend to around 4 hours. For those who enjoy scenic routes, driving a car can take about 7 hours, allowing for flexibility and exploration along the way. Alternatively, buses are available with a travel time of around 10-12 hours, making it a budget-friendly choice for travelers who don’t mind a longer journey. Flights are recommended for business travelers or those short on time, while driving is ideal for families or groups looking to enjoy the journey.
